Output e1421eb829b5adc4e052b377f6c43316ce21cd308143a8ac3ec6b0a61e0f5d08:1

value
18455986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e892bd71a1b768851f5e6cd7bcd170b772e58e OP_EQUAL
address
MJ6srC8tSbGFWPyUMDH8gy6iCKPSqSmJe8
transaction
e1421eb829b5adc4e052b377f6c43316ce21cd308143a8ac3ec6b0a61e0f5d08
spent
true